Description:
Dihydroxymethoxyacetophenone hydrate, with the CAS number 708-53-2, is a chemical compound that typically features a phenolic structure, characterized by the presence of hydroxyl (-OH) groups and a methoxy (-OCH₃) group attached to an acetophenone backbone. This compound is often utilized in various applications, including organic synthesis and as an intermediate in the production of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its hydrate form indicates that it contains water molecules in its crystalline structure, which can influence its solubility and stability. The presence of multiple functional groups suggests that it may exhibit interesting reactivity, making it a candidate for further chemical transformations. Additionally, the compound's physical properties, such as melting point and solubility, can vary based on its hydration state and purity. As with many organic compounds, safety precautions should be observed when handling this substance, as it may pose health risks or environmental hazards.
Formula:C9H10O4
InChI:InChI=1/C9H10O4/c1-5(10)6-3-4-7(13-2)9(12)8(6)11/h3-4,11-12H,1-2H3
SMILES:CC(=O)c1ccc(c(c1O)O)OC
Synonyms:
  • 2,3-Dihydroxy-4-methoxyacetohpenone
  • 1-(2,3-Dihydroxy-4-Methoxyphenyl)Ethanone
  • 2,3-Dihydroxy-4-Methoxyacetophenone
